Output 26493783d2b276242c6e10452125b4c4e2ab20ff843a462d3128eb134243072d:0

value
890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c758e7be2cd261f2f9f8283479eacc511dd5ea6d OP_EQUAL
address
3Ks4txnzjnDv6VR52JcBamPEk4VnZYC7Lo
transaction
26493783d2b276242c6e10452125b4c4e2ab20ff843a462d3128eb134243072d
spent
true